Our Pastor
Reflections from Pastor Loring on his life and ministry:
Pastor Loring majored in biology at Eastern University, reflecting his life-long appreciation of nature, and taught high school for two years in Erie, PA following graduation in 1978. But God kept calling and he enrolled in Eastern Baptist (now Palmer) Theological Seminary, Wynnewood, PA, to reconcile his faith with his scientific background. During his junior year, he met Kim and they were married the following year. After graduating in 1983, he became associate pastor of West Shore Baptist Church in Camp Hill, PA in the Harrisburg area. Their two daughters, Kelly and Heather were born there. Kelly, now 24, works in a local daycare center and Heather, 22, is now studying at Palmer Seminary; both live in Wayne, PA. On Community Involvement:
Wherever we have lived I have tried to find ways to become involved with the greater community. In Camp Hill, that led me to the yoke fellowship meetings that were held with inmates at the Camp Hill state prison. In Willow Grove, I was involved with a crisis prevention group that worked with three local police departments, then with the Community Policing Department in Abington. In Point Pleasant, I became the official photographer for the local volunteer Fire Company.
All of these experiences have exposed me to different people and different experiences of life. I believe that they have helped me to be more understanding and sympathetic.
